A fan uses magnets by generating a magnetic field that interacts with electric current, which creates a force that drives the fan blades to rotate. This rotation creates airflow, providing cooling or ventilation in various applications. Magnets play a crucial role in converting electrical energy into mechanical energy in a fan.

The magnet in an electrical fan is used in the motor to produce a rotating magnetic field. This rotating magnetic field interacts with the coils of wire in the motor, causing them to rotate and drive the fan blades. In essence, the magnet helps convert electrical energy into mechanical energy to power the fan.

Not all fans do need a magnet - there are hand fans, punkah walla fans belt driven fans (as in your car) and Stirling engine fans that I can think of that do not need a magnet. It is only electrically driven fans that require a magnet because they work on the principles of electromagnetism.
A fan needs a coil and magnet to create an electromagnetic field that induces movement in the fan blades when an electric current is applied. The coil carries the electric current, while the magnet is used to generate the magnetic field necessary for rotation. This interaction produces the mechanical energy needed to rotate the fan blades and create airflow.
